klutched Posted August 2, 2021 Report Share Posted August 2, 2021 Hey guys, Sorry if this isnt the right section. Running a G4+ NGTR in my 33 with a Link MXP strada. Currently have the fuel level hooked up via my MXP through a haltech fuel level conditioner. I went through and added 2L increments of fuel and took the mV readings from the aim live values and punched them all into the table to set up fuel level. I got to 34L and it read 30mV, and then put another 2L in and went to -40mV.... so obviously in the aim software you cant put negative values in so i only got to 34L. Ive currently got it showing Liters used from full and on a full tank its showing -15L and as I use more fuel it goes positive. Anyone know why i would be getting negative values? Thanks Liters mV 0 1635mv4 1660mv6 1450mv8 139010 124512 110014 101516 90018 84520 70022 62524 55026 46528 30030 20032 13534 3036 -4038 -11040 -18541.5 -245 values for reference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Adamw Posted August 2, 2021 Report Share Posted August 2, 2021 You dont even need the conditioner, you can connect the sensor direct to the dash, you do need to wire in a a pull-up resistor though. I suspect there is a conflict between the haltech device and the dash ground or something. https://www.aim-sportline.com/download/faqs/eng/hardware/sensors/FAQ_Sensors_Fuel_level_100_eng.pdf klutched 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
